Shirley Christian Roberts Stapleton June 11, 2024
CHURCH HILL - Shirley Christian Roberts Stapleton passed away peacefully at her home on June 11, 2024. She was born in Church Hill, TN and worked as a teacher, then guidance counselor at CHHS and VHS, retiring in 2001. She was an active member at FBC of Church Hill.
Most importantly, Shirley was a loving mother, grandmother, family member, and friend. She had an enthusiasm for life and an unwavering love for her Savior. Her selflessness and kindness were evident to all that knew her. Shirley leaves behind a legacy of love, gratitude, and faithfulness.
Shirley was preceded in death by first husband Arlen Eugene Roberts and second husband Charles Stapleton; her parents FM and Gertrude Christian; daughter Tammy Moore; sister Marceleen Renfro (Wallace); and brothers Glenn "Boot" Christian and Don Christian.
Shirley is survived by her son Chris Roberts (Megan) and son-in-law Richard Moore; grandchildren Daniel Roberts (Chrissy) and Angela Foster (Cameron) (mother Rose Roberts), Magnolia Roberts, Christian Roberts, Clayton Moore, Chad Moore (Wilder); great-grandchildren Andrew Locke, Gage Roberts, Weston Roberts, Harper Foster, Adalynn Foster, and Fletcher Foster; sister Loretta Winstead (Bill); brother Ken Christian (Melissa); sisters-in-law Shirley Christian and Patricia Christian; members of the Stapleton family; and a number of special nieces and nephews.
A visitation will be held from 10:00 a.m.- 12:00 p.m. on Saturday, June 15, 2024, at Johnson-Arrowood Funeral Home. The funeral service will follow in the funeral home chapel. A graveside service will follow at Church Hill Memory Gardens.
In lieu of flowers, memorial contributions may be made to the Alzheimer's Association in her name.
